Transaction 5037b82f9f793b379ec4938a3750c4d95981a4670f4242c6d5dc91a7beefdaa2
1 Input
2 Outputs
- 5037b82f9f793b379ec4938a3750c4d95981a4670f4242c6d5dc91a7beefdaa2:0
- 5037b82f9f793b379ec4938a3750c4d95981a4670f4242c6d5dc91a7beefdaa2:1
value 21812641
address 18pNEtLxaKXxaceXFHTr3ib86whvGv1NJY
value 4734326
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c